Output dd7c79b31ab1df5bfe4fddf68135ef34ad0904819be3caddf1265c9c691b4ba3:2

value
617253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2012be847835caf4688f9dbeef3dc5c16968a62a OP_EQUAL
address
34cc141qKyjuaKyhhzehxB92GoXCHU2wHc
transaction
dd7c79b31ab1df5bfe4fddf68135ef34ad0904819be3caddf1265c9c691b4ba3
spent
true